Neuberger Berman
Overview
Neuberger Berman is seeking a skilled and detail-oriented professional to join our Production Compensation Team within the Finance group. In this role, you will support the end-to-end compensation process for our Global Institutional and Intermediary sales teams, contributing to innovation, efficiency, and insights that assist the firm’s financial planning. The position involves working closely with Payroll, Client Billing, Fund Admin, HCM Business Partners, Client Coverage Management, and Technology to help ensure the effective execution of the sales compensation process. You will have the opportunity to apply your analytical and technical expertise to inform decision-making and contribute to ongoing improvements in workflows and technology. Key Responsibilities
Own the Process: Ensure timely, accurate, and efficient processing of monthly, quarterly, and annual compensation calculations for production-based teams; review and distribute detailed compensation statements to sales teams Problem-Solve with Precision: Perform root-cause analysis for payout variances and deliver clear, data-driven explanations to Client Coverage Management teams Deliver Insights: Prepare compensation trend analysis and forecasts to senior management Financial Oversight: Record compensation expense transactions in the general ledger, including assessment of P&L impact and performing balance sheet reconciliations Collaborate Across Teams: Work with HCM, Technology, and Client Coverage Management to implement compensation plans accurately and resolve issues effectively Drive Innovation: Support the design, testing, and implementation of technology enhancements to optimize compensation processes Enhance Efficiency: Identify and recommend process and data improvements to increase scalability, accuracy, and efficiency across workflows Qualifications
Bachelor's degree in accounting or finance 4-6 years of experience in accounting, financial reporting, and analysis Experience with commission-based compensation is required Asset Management/Investment Advisory industry expertise is preferred Advanced proficiency in Microsoft Excel and PowerPoint is essential; knowledge of SAP is a plus Strong communication skills (both written and verbal); ability to communicate clearly to senior management and other key stakeholders Exceptional attention to detail, organizational skills, and problem-solving abilities Ability to balance multiple priorities under tight deadlines in a high-profile, fast-paced environment Collaborative mindset with a willingness to contribute to a variety of initiatives Compensation
The salary range for this role is $105,000-$130,000. This range reflects what we in good faith believe we would pay at the time of posting. The actual pay may be higher or lower and is subject to modification. Pay position within the range is based on factors including education, qualifications, certifications, experience, skills, seniority, geographic location, business needs, and performance. This role is eligible for a discretionary bonus and a comprehensive benefits package including paid time off, medical/dental/vision insurance, 401(k), life insurance, and more.
